这个问题在这个论坛中讨论了很多次,并且给出了许多根据具体情况适用的解决方案。我遇到了这个问题,并发现 1 天后发生了这个问题,因为在创建存储帐户时我启用了“需要安全传输” "选项,因此每当我尝试挂载此文件共享时,都会出现错误。
现在我的问题是:
- 我在 Microsoft 知识库中找不到任何要求不要执行此操作的文档。
- 为什么这是一个首要问题。启用此选项不会使我的文件共享更加安全。
- 启用此选项后,我可以以任何方式挂载我的文件共享吗?
我使用的是cento 7.4
最佳答案
I could not find any documentation in Microsoft knowledge base asking to not do this.
“需要安全传输”选项仅允许通过安全连接向帐户发出请求,从而增强存储帐户的安全性。例如,当您调用 REST API 来访问您的存储帐户时,您必须使用 HTTPS 进行连接。 “需要安全传输”拒绝使用 HTTP 的请求。
Why i this an issue in first place. Isnt enabling this option make my file share more secure.
这里有一个类似的case关于你,请引用。
Can I mount my file share in any way with this option enabled?
Centos 7.4支持SMB 3.0的加密功能,我们应该关闭所需的安全传输,并直接挂载。
When you use the Azure Files service, any connection without encryption fails when "Secure transfer required" is enabled. This includes scenarios that use SMB 2.1, SMB 3.0 without encryption, and some versions of the Linux SMB client.
更多有关安全传输所需的信息,请参阅此article .
关于azure - 挂载 Azure 文件共享导致挂载错误(13) :Permission denied,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/47767283/